Installing a built-in Microwave could require an expert installation or kitchen remodel. You may be able to, based on the layout of your house to cut a hole in a wall for the appliance. However, this will require professional framing and strengthening. In addition, microwaves with built-ins require adequate ventilation to avoid overheating and damaging the appliance. According to Sam Cipiti, vice president of R. M. Tunis Kitchens and Baths in Chevy Chase, Maryland, the minimum cabinet depth for a built-in microwave is around 15 inches, however certain manufacturers offer trim kits that offer up to 1 1/2 inches of additional space to let air circulate.

In this supplemental notice of proposed rulemaking ("SNOPR") the Office of Energy Efficiency and Renewable Energy proposes new or modified energy conservation standards for microwave ovens which will help consumers save money on operating costs. The Energy Policy and Conservation Act (EPCA) requires DOE to regularly assess whether more stringent standards are technologically feasible and economically viable and if they can result in significant energy savings.

This SNOPR provides the analysis and results that DOE carried out to assess the effects on consumers of the new or amended energy conservation standards for microwave ovens. The analysis includes a technology and market assessment, a screening and engineering analysis, and an analysis of the impact on the nation.

The energy use analysis calculates the average annual microwave oven operating hours in homes that have been sampled for representativeness. This analysis is used to calculate energy savings and other consumer analysis within this SNOPR. The analysis is based on RECS field data from multiple regions, and takes into account the different usage patterns of microwave ovens across different households, as well as the variations in the regional electricity prices.

To assess the impact of potential new or modified standards on household operating costs, DOE conducted LCC and PBP analyses to estimate the cost over time of purchasing and using microwave ovens at different efficiency levels. The LCC and PBP calculations employ an algorithm that is based on Monte Carlo simulations to incorporate uncertainty and variation into the analysis.

In addition to the analyses of energy use and LCC/PBP In addition to the energy-use and LCC/PBP analyses, this SNOPR includes an assessment of the national impacts of new or amended standards using the NIA spreadsheet model. The NIA model calculates the industry's net present value ("INPV") in terms of energy savings resulting from the potential amendment or new standards in the form of energy savings on site and FFC energy savings.
